Hello,I'd like to know if old V75 wheels could fit my V50? And how about electric starter motor, are these small block's starters the same?Thank you in advance for your help!
I put a Nevada 750 transmission into a Monza and the Monza starter fit fine. The reverse should be the same.The wheels might be made to fit, but there are hurdles both front and rear. If you don't have the parts side by side, you might get some help from parts books for both bikes. http://www.thisoldtractor.com/moto_guzzi_small_blocks_spare_parts_catalogs___exploded_parts_diagrams___parts_fiche.htmlThe spacing between the fork legs is narrower on the original V50 forks than V65 forks and thus probably all larger and later bikes. Greater distance between the fork legs means the brake rotor spacing is probably wrong. And if the rotors are larger diameter on the later bike the V50 rotors might have to fit the V75 wheel. If the bearing spacing is different on the V75 wheels you may also have to axles or spacers. The rear brake changed sides at some point so it would have to switch sides if even possible. Cush drive rubbers also changed at some point but not sure if that affects how the rear wheel engages the rear drive.
